    Let \(Q\equiv \{(x,t):\) \(0<x<1\), \(0<t<T\}\). The author looks for a solution \(u\in C^{2,1}(\bar Q)\) of the equation \[ [a(t,u)]_ t=(k(x,t,u,u_ x)u_ x)_ x+d(x,t,u,u_ x)u_ x+f(x,t,u)\quad in\quad Q \] under initial and boundary conditions \[ u(x,0)=u_ 0(x),\quad u_ 0(x)\in H^{2+\alpha}[0,1],\quad u_ 0'(x)\geq 0, \] \[ Ku_{x|_{x=0}}=\psi_ 1(t)\geq 0,\quad ku_{x|_{x=1}}=\psi_ 2(t)\geq 0,\quad \psi_ 2(t)\in H^{1+\alpha /2}[0,T] \] and matching conditions of zero order. Conditions for the positiveness of the derivative of the solution of the problem under consideration are formulated.
